Also, it contains the Revenue of orders like Profit, loss, and discount.\u003cbr\u003e\n\n***Business Problem***\n\nA Sales Manager wants to understand different priority orders with their order quantities and revenue generation on them to prepare Business Strategy accordingly. They also want to check which region stores are giving good Margins and a consistent number of orders over time.\u003cbr\u003e\n\n**Performed Data Transformation on Store Sales Data before building Visuals -\u003e**\n\n1. Cleaned the unnecessary(blank) columns or rows.\u003cbr\u003e\n2. Splited Column Location in Orders table by using custom delimiter colon (:) and renamed new columns to Region and State.\u003cbr\u003e\n3. Added a new custom column in the Revenue table named ‘ Discounted Shipping Price’ by using formula (Shipping Cost - Discount).\u003cbr\u003e\n4. Created an Index Column in the Orders table with name “Order Sl. No” ranging from 1 with increment of 1.\u003cbr\u003e\n5. Changed Data type of Order ID, Order Sl. No and Customer ID to text in Orders Table.\u003cbr\u003e\n6. Added a conditional column in the Revenue table named ‘Profitable Order’ with condition Profit \u003e 1000 and provided values as : if Profit \u003e 1000 (Yes) else (No).\u003cbr\u003e\n\n**Problem Statement**\n1.
